The High Electoral Court (TSE) and the Ministry of Justice and Public Security signed on Tuesday (15) an agreement establishing rules for the operation of the Federal Road Police (PRF) during the elections of 2026. The joint decree provides for actions to police, monitor and patrol federal highways and determines the cooperation of the corporation with the Electoral Justice to ensure the free exercise of the vote.
